Exploring the Origins of Gothic Literature
This chapter delves into the origins of Gothic literature, discussing influential authors like Horace Walpole and Anne Radcliffe in the 1790s. It explores the blend of ancient and modern romance in Gothic narratives, emphasizing the tension between the supernatural and the realistic. The chapter also touches on the connection between Gothic literature and the decadent writers of the 19th century, highlighting how Gothic narratives emerged from a mix of folklore, legends, and mythology.
